History-sheeter hacked to death in Vyasarpadi


In a shocking incident, a notorious history-sheeter identified as “Thondai Raj,” also known as Rowdy Raji, was brutally hacked to death in Vyasarpadi, a northern suburb of Chennai. The murder took place in the Sathyamoorthy Nagar area, sending shockwaves across the locality known for its history of gang-related activities.

According to police sources, Thondai Raj had recently been released from prison, just about a month ago. His return to the locality was closely watched by law enforcement agencies due to his past involvement in several criminal activities. Despite that, he was targeted and killed in what appears to be a premeditated attack.
Eyewitnesses reported that a gang surrounded Raj and attacked him with deadly weapons in broad daylight, leaving him with fatal injuries. He died on the spot before any help could arrive.
Police personnel rushed to the scene and cordoned off the area for investigation. Forensic teams were deployed to gather evidence, and initial inquiries suggest that the murder may be the result of long-standing enmity or rivalry within the criminal underworld.
The Vyasarpadi police have registered a case and are actively pursuing leads to identify and apprehend the assailants. Meanwhile, local residents remain tense as the gruesome killing has once again highlighted the volatile law and order situation in certain parts of the city.
